2. Factors to Consider When Choosing a Cardiology Clinic

Choosing a cardiology clinic isn’t as simple as picking a random location; there are several important factors to consider. From my experience, the first thing to look for is the expertise of the cardiologists. A cardiology clinic with experienced and board-certified cardiologists will have the knowledge to diagnose your condition accurately and provide the best treatment options. I found that researching the doctors’ qualifications and areas of specialization was key to feeling confident in the clinic I chose.

2.1. Technology and Equipment

The technology and equipment available at a cardiology clinic is another crucial factor. When I went in for my heart tests, I realized how important it was to have access to cutting-edge diagnostic tools. Clinics with advanced technology such as echocardiograms, stress tests, and ECG machines ensure that your heart health can be assessed comprehensively. It’s also important to check if the clinic offers non-invasive testing options, which are typically more comfortable and have fewer risks.

3. Understanding the Heart Tests Available at Cardiology Clinics

One of the most important things I learned during my journey was understanding the types of heart tests available and what they could tell about my health. At a quality cardiology clinic, you’ll have access to a wide range of tests designed to assess heart function and diagnose potential problems early. Some of the most common heart tests include:

3.1. Electrocardiogram (ECG)

An ECG is a fundamental test used to assess the electrical activity of the heart. It helps detect arrhythmias, heart attacks, and other heart-related conditions. When I underwent this test, the cardiologist was able to pinpoint an issue I hadn’t known about, which led to early treatment and better outcomes.

3.2. Echocardiogram

During my tests, I also had an echocardiogram, which uses sound waves to create a picture of the heart. This test provides detailed information about the heart’s structure and function, which is vital for diagnosing conditions like heart valve issues or cardiomyopathy. This was one of the tests that gave me the clarity I needed about my heart’s health.

3.3. Stress Tests

Stress tests are used to evaluate how your heart performs under physical exertion. If you’re like me, the idea of exercising while being monitored can seem daunting, but it’s an excellent way for doctors to assess your cardiovascular health under stress. It’s a test that provides valuable data, especially if you have concerns about your heart’s performance during physical activity.
